Speaking at the Uttar Pradesh International Trade Show - 2025 (UPITS-2025) at Greater Noida in Gautam Buddha Nagar, the CM said that the GST reforms had brought a new kind of liveliness in the markets, which had also proved to be a new life for the ODOP sector industrialists.
Russia will participate as a partner country. Over 2,400 exhibitors, 1,25,000 B2B visitors and 4,50,000 B2C visitors are expected to take part in the trade show.
